nurbs aren’t as flexible as spines, but in blender are as close as you’re going to get

nurbs surfaces are made entierly of quads in a grid pattern

splines dont’ have this restrition, but also aren’t in blender

instead of wanting splines in blender, it is usually a better idea to learn how to use surbsurf [on a mesh]

Is it spacebar-Add-Curve?

Use Add-Surface-NURB Curve. You can loft selected splines with FKEY or Make Segment from the Surface menu. There are Make Cyclic options for both u and v directions.

Surface Curves can be lofted. Curve Curves cannot.

Patch/Spline modelling for characters has largely been replaced in the industry by subsurf modelling which is quite a bit more flexible. The reason you find so many patch/spline modelling tutorials is because they existed for all the major packages before subsurf modelling became common. Spline modelling is however still used extensively for parts design/industrial uses since cutting tools and other machinery can easily be programmed to follow the mathematical splines. So for modelling your characters subsurfs is the way to go. I suggest you google for the infamous “Joan of Arc” tutorial which while not written for blender, shows most of the techniques now commonly used for character modelling.
